Abstract

Publications in the field of Artificial Intelligence (AI) are growing remarkably in the last decade. This can be explained by the fact that AI applications have become widespread in scientific and industrial fields. Education is one of the most relevant domains where AI applications can improve quality and equity in access, according to UNESCO [1] recommendations. Following this global trend, higher education institutions in developing countries, as in advanced countries, have taken measures and approaches to implement AI solutions. Despites the lack of clear national strategies in many of them, several interesting use cases are identified through our literature review performed between 2012 and 2022. We aim with our work to explore applications of AI in the field of engineering education and in the context of Higher Education institutions in developing countries. Our approach shows prioritised AI applications in such countries and how those applications are exploited to prepare graduates to meet industrial needs by classifying findings and organizing them in a concepts map. © 2023 IEEE.
